Laripur® 5018B is a fully transparent and soft th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) based on polyester. This phthalate-free plasticized TPU is designed for fast processing cycles, making it particularly suitable for the production of high-flexibility soles with antislip properties. The transparent appearance adds esthetic appeal to the final product.

Polymer Name: Thermoplastic Polyurethane (Polyester based)

End Uses: Footwear

Processing Recommendations

Predrying Condition: Material needs to be dried prior processing at 175 ° - 195°F for 3 hours, preferably using a dehumidifying drier feeded by air exhibiting a dew point lower than -22°F.
Processing: 
Indicative Suggested Molding Temperature Profile

  °C
Zone 1 310
Zone 2 320
Zone 3 325
Nozzle 320

Being affected by type of machine used, processing condition and downstream equipment, the temperature profiles as given above has to be considered just as indicative.

Properties

Physical Form
Physico-Chemical Properties
ValueUnitsTest Method / Conditions
Tensile Strength3625psiASTM D412
Tensile Modulus (at 50%)145psiASTM D412
Tensile Modulus (at 300%)725psiASTM D412
Tensile Modulus (at 100%)380psiASTM D412
Tear Strength31N/mmASTM D624
Specific Gravity1.18g/cm³ASTM D792
Shore Hardness52A ScaleASTM D2240
Compression Set (at 70h/23°C)15%ASTM D395
Abrasion Loss80mm³DIN 53516
Elongation (at Break)900%ASTM D412
Compression Set (at 22h/70°C)30%ASTM D395

Packaging Information

Laripur® 5018B is supplied in regular pellet form and it is packaged in 25 kg bags or 500 kg and 1000 kg octabins.

Storage & Handling

Shelf Life
6 months
Storage and Shelf Life Conditions

Material has to be kept in its original package in a cool dry place repared from  sun and weather. In these conditions the shelf life is six months from date of delivery
